Nike Pegasus 41 Product Review

 The Nike Pegasus series has long been a favorite among runners, and the Pegasus 41 continues this legacy with some notable updates. Here’s a detailed look at its features, performance, and overall value. 

 Design and Build Quality


The Nike Pegasus 41 maintains the classic look that fans of the series love, but with some modern tweaks. The shoe features a new ReactX midsole, which is designed to provide a more responsive and cushioned ride. The upper is made from a breathable mesh material that ensures good ventilation, keeping your feet cool during long runs. The shoe also includes a rockered sole, enhancing the heel-to-toe transition

 Performance

The Pegasus 41 is particularly well-suited for heel strikers, thanks to its plush foam and rockered sole1. It offers a balanced amount of cushioning, making it ideal for daily training runs. The shoe is flexible and provides good traction, even on wet surfaces. However, it has a firmer ride compared to some other daily trainers, which might not appeal to everyone2.

 Features

  • ReactX Midsole: Provides a responsive and cushioned ride with a 43% reduction in carbon footprint compared to previous models2.
  • Breathable Upper: Ensures good ventilation and comfort during runs1.
  • Rockered Sole: Enhances heel-to-toe transition, making it ideal for heel strikers1.
  • Durability: The shoe is built to last, with a robust outsole that can handle many miles1.


Pros and Cons

Pros:

  • Comfortable and breathable upper
  • Good traction on various surfaces
  • Durable construction
  • Enhanced for heel strikers
  • Sustainable features with reduced carbon footprint

Cons:

  • Firmer ride might not suit everyone
  • Slightly heavier than previous versions
  • Price increase compared to the Pegasus 402


Conclusion

The Nike Pegasus 41 is a solid choice for runners looking for a reliable daily trainer. Its combination of comfort, durability, and performance makes it a great option for both beginners and experienced runners. While it may not be the best choice for those seeking a softer ride or a lightweight shoe, its overall benefits make it a worthwhile investment.
